2022 Supreme(Del) 136

JASMEET SINGH
Surender Kumar – Appellant
Versus
State Of NCT Of Delhi –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
Mr Dhananjay Singh Sehrawat, Advocate, for the Appellant, Mr Ranbir S Kundu, Asc For State, Mr Mukul Dagar, Ms Pooja, Mr Naresh Dagar, Advs, for the Respondent.

ORDER

1. This is a petition seeking setting aside/modifying the judgment dated 25.10.2021 passed by learned ASJ-02, North-East District, Karkardooma Courts, Delhi and further to expunge the remarks made against the petitioner and to set aside the direction of initiating inquiry against the petitioner.

2. The petitioner in the present case is the Investigating Officer who had conducted investigation in FIR No. 428/2011, Police Station - New Usmanpur, under Section 302 IPC. The learned ASJ in his order dated 25.10.2021 set aside the order dated 17.10.2019 passed by the Court of learned Metropolitan Magistrate, and while doing so, the learned ASJ in para 17 of the order observed as under:
